Long Beach was the 47-41 winner over Moss Point when they last played one another back in December of 2023, but their luck changed this time around. The Long Beach Bearcats fell 65-52 to the Moss Point Tigers on Friday. The Bearcats have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Jujuan Nettles was nothing short of spectacular for Moss Point: he dropped a double-double on 25 points and ten boards. The dominant performance gave Nettles a new career-high in points. Treylynn Anderson was another key player, putting up ten points and three steals.
Long Beach's loss dropped their record down to 4-12. As for Moss Point, their victory bumped their record up to 4-10.
Long Beach w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next contest, a 58-20 defeat against Biloxi on the 21st. As for Moss Point,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next game, a 73-47 loss against Magee on the 21st.
